1. Council approval is based on the site plan submitted by the applicant and <br />annotated by City staff, attached to this Resolution as Exhibit A. Any <br />amendments to the site plan which are not in conformity with City codes will <br />require further Planning Commission and City Council review. <br />2. Hardcover in the 500 ’-1000 ’ zone shall not increase above 35%. Applicant is <br />advised that any requests to increase hardcover above 35% shall require City <br />approval, and increases in hardcover will not likely be approved without <br />concurrent reductions in existing hardcover. <br />3. Applicant shall remove all plastic or fabric liner material from the decorative <br />landscape beds on the property to ensure their permeability as non-hardcover <br />surfaces. <br />4. Required Heruiepin County Health Department site remediaiion shall be <br />completed prior to issuance of a building permit. Tliis work can be conducted <br />congruently with a demolition pemiit for the existing house and any out <br />buildings. <br />5. Authorities granted by this resolu >n run with the property not with the applicant, <br />but are permissive only and must be exercised by obtaining a building permit for <br />the new construction within one year of the date of Council approval, or the <br />variance will expire on that date (June 28,2005). <br />6. Violation of or non-compliance with any of the terms and conditions of this <br />resolution shall constitute a violation of the zoning code, shall automatically <br />terminate any authority granted herein, and shall be punishable as a misdemeanor. <br />S <br />7. The undersigned applicant has read, understood and hereby agrees to the terms of <br />this resolution and on behalf of the applicant and the applicant ’s heirs, successors <br />and assigns, hereby agrees to the recording of this resolution in the chain of title <br />of the property. <br />Page 3 of 5
